The Tavern in Old Salem

The Tavern in Old Salem serves up Moravian-inspired meal in an authentic historic setting. The staff is dressed in traditional Moravian garb. Chicken pies, Smoked blue cheese bisque, and gingerbread with lemon ice-cream are a few delicious selections served at this restaurant. The breads and desserts are made from scratch. Relish the delicious Moravian-inspired meal with craft beers in the restaurant’s cozy, candle-lit dining rooms.

Noble’s Grille

Noble’s Grille serves up Southern fare with international flair prepared with local ingredients. It is an elegant restaurant with open kitchen and dining area.  It serves everything from delicious appetizers to entrees. A French-Mediterranean menu full of options like smoked BBQ pork, fried oyster salad, filet mignon, and hummingbird cake, anything you order would be delish.

Meridian Restaurant

If your taste buds are getting bored, head off to Meridian Restaurant that puts out Mediterranean and innovative American food. The food has Italian, contemporary, French and international influences. The menu is full of creative dishes made from local and organic ingredients. From sausages to breads and pasta, everything is made in-house. It also has a bar serving wide variety of cocktails.
